Futurama - Season 3

Season 3

Episodes

The Honking
When the inheritance Bender claims in the Old Country isn't quite what he expected, the Planet Express crew has to find the source of an age-old curse.

War Is the H-Word
When Bender and Fry volunteer for military duty, Leela also joins the all-male ranks, as Lee Lemon.

The Cryonic Woman
Fry is reunited with his girlfriend from the 20th century.

Parasites Lost
The crew takes a trip inside Fry's body to save him from parasitic worms.

Amazon Women in the Mood
The crew gets stranded on a planet of Amazonian women.

Bendless Love
Bender gets jealous when he thinks his new fembot love might still love her ex.

The Day the Earth Stood Stupid
Only Fry's superior inferior brain can save the day when knowledge-sucking alien brains invade.

That's Lobstertainment!
Dr. Zoidberg heads to Hollywood to help his washed-up uncle revive his film career.

The Birdbot of Ice-Catraz
Leela fights to save the penguins of Pluto after an oil spill.

Luck of the Fryrish
Fry travels to Old New York to retrieve his lucky clover.

The Cyber House Rules
A trip to the orphanarium leads Leela to get cosmetic surgery and Bender to adopt 12 orphans.

Insane in the Mainframe
Fry thinks he's a robot after being brainwashed at an insane robot asylum.

Bendin' in the Wind
A paralyzed Bender joins rock star Beck on the concert road.

Time Keeps on Slipping
The crew is responsible for a rift in the time/space continuum.

I Dated a Robot
Fry falls in love with a Lucy Liu robot.
